Chikka Tumkur is a Rural village located in Dodda-ballapur, Bengaluru-rural, Karnataka.

The total population of Chikka Tumkur is 898.

Chikka Tumkur village comprises 210 households.

The literacy rate in Chikka Tumkur is 81.6%. Among the literate population of 650, there are 366 literate males and 284 literate females.

In Chikka Tumkur, there are 469 males and 429 females, with a sex ratio of 915 females per 1000 males.

There are 101 children (11.2% of population), comprising 56 boys and 45 girls.

The total number of workers in Chikka Tumkur is 534, with 261 main workers and 273 marginal workers.

In Chikka Tumkur, there are 515 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(268 males, 247 females) and 3 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(2 males, 1 females).

Chikka Tumkur is located in Karnataka state, Bengaluru-rural district, and falls under Dodda-ballapur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 625125 and LGD code is 625125.
